Nationwide, classrooms with connection facilities can schedule programs which are fun, interactive and informative. Interested parties can contact our distance provider, CILC. HAIL TO THE CHIEF: GRADES 3 THROUGH 5
Students learn the six jobs that every U.S. President must fulfill. The history of the song “Hail To the Chief” is explored. Benjamin Harrison enactor Ed Myers speaks to the participants.

“IS THE UNITED STATES A DEMOCRACY?” GRADES 3 THROUGH 8
Should we call the United States government a Democracy? Students learn how our system of government came to be, and exactly what form of government we have. Activities involve students in active citizenship.

THE EVERYDAY LIFE OF A CIVIL WAR SOLDIER: GRADES 3 THROUGH 8
Students review Harrison’s wartime letters and the diary of Confederate soldier John Weatherred. The causes of the war and the realities of a soldier’s life are analyzed. Students break into teams to answer questions.
